WebbExemptions from jury service; Apply for an excusal or deferral. If you are summoned to court for jury service, you may have a reason why you can't be there. Sometimes a judge can allow you to put back your service until a later date or excuse you for that sitting, a particular trial or period of time if you have a good reason. WebbAt what age are you exempt from jury service in the UK? Anyone aged 18 or over on the electoral register can be summoned for jury service. You can apply to be excused if you're aged 71 or over. In these circumstances you can apply for an exemption up until the date you attend court, but it may be helpful to let the court know as soon as possible.
